Acronyms, Abbreviations, and Initialisms.
All human edited and we add more daily

The meaning of the Acronym ATRS is...

ATRS is

  • Air Transport Research Society

More Meanings For ATRS:

  • Air Transport Research Society
  • Air Transport Research Society

ATRS is also in:

Acronym Definition Searched: END CCWC CCCC EDGE MT DIV IWMS OUTBOARD SIN GO UMTS TOK CDR BBR FAT